
A Bell Gardens man was charged Wednesday with the murders of two brothers at Ruben Salazar Park in East Los Angeles last November.
Pedro Vasquez, 23, is scheduled to be arraigned April 27 in connection with the Nov. 22, 2015, killings of Antonio Aguilar, 33, and Juan Aguilar, 28, who had once dated the defendant’s sister.
The murder charges include the special circumstance allegation of multiple murders. Prosecutors will decide later whether to seek the death penalty against him.
Vasquez allegedly approached the brothers at the park and opened fire on them, with both suffering multiple gunshot wounds, according to the Los Angeles County District Attorney’s Office.
Authorities have not disclosed a motive for the shooting.
